Pawlenty Joins Grocery Software Provider Board

ATLANTA — Tim Pawlenty, the former governor of Minnesota who stepped down as a candidate for the Republican presidential nomination in August, has joined the board of directors of RedPrairie here, a technology supplier to the grocery and other industries.

RedPrairie supplies supply chain, workforce, and other retail software systems; its food retailer customers include Publix, Loblaw, Supervalu and Hy-Vee.

"I'm impressed with RedPrairie's visionary strategy," said Pawlenty, in a statement. "RedPrairie is at the forefront of the movement to connect the supply chain and consumers in this rapidly evolving global economy."
